Getting involved - having your say

Accent Nene's Resident Involvement team works with residents to help improve the quality of life for all. We are committed to involving, consulting and informing residents about the management of their homes and provide lots of opportunities for you to have your say.

Getting involved gives you the chance to meet people, learn new skills and find new ways of engaging with your community. You can get lots out of being an involved resident; you can directly influence and improve what Accent Nene does and increase your knowledge of different subjects.

We recognise that residents will wish to be involved in different ways, depending on their personal circumstances and we have developed a variety of methods to enable residents to choose the most suitable ways for them to be involved. Being involved doesn't mean attending a meeting, although this is one of the options. If this is not your cup of tea we offer other ways for you to contribute including telephone meetings, internet discussion groups, mystery shopping, scheme walk-abouts, surveys and much more.

To help residents become involved we also help with transport and child care costs, and provide administrative support, assistance on newsletter production and funding advice
